The term "middle schoolers" refers to students who are in middle school, typically between the ages of 10 and 14. Middle schools are educational institutions that provide a transition phase for children moving from elementary school to high school. These students are at an age where they experience significant physical, emotional, and cognitive changes as their bodies grow and develop rapidly. The phrase "middle schoolers" is commonly used to describe this specific age group of students who attend middle schools or junior high schools.
